Overview

Lee Marshall Bass, commonly known as Lee Bass, is an American billionaire businessman and philanthropist. He is one of the four Bass brothers, who inherited a substantial fortune from their oil tycoon father, Perry Bass. Lee Bass is currently the chairman and CEO of Bass Enterprises Production Company, which focuses on oil and gas exploration and production.

Early Life and Education

Lee Bass was born on November 13, 1956, in Fort Worth, Texas. He is the youngest son of Perry Richardson Bass and Nancy Lee Bass. Lee grew up in a wealthy family, attending the best private schools in Texas. He graduated from St. Mark’s School of Texas in 1975 and went on to pursue a degree in mechanical engineering at Vanderbilt University. However, he dropped out after his sophomore year to focus on his family’s business.

Career and Achievements

Lee Bass began his career in the family business in the mid-1970s, working alongside his brothers to manage the Bass Brothers Enterprises portfolio. He played a key role in the family’s investments beyond the oil and gas industry, including real estate and investments in companies such as Disney and American Airlines. In 1984, Bass and his brothers made a successful bid to acquire a controlling interest in the Walt Disney Company.

In addition to his business pursuits, Lee Bass is also an avid art collector and philanthropist. He serves on the board of various cultural institutions, including the Kimbell Art Museum and the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th. He also founded the Lee and Ramona Bass Foundation, which supports various causes in education, the arts, and medical research.

Personal Life

Lee Bass is notoriously private, and little is known about his personal life. He is married to Ramona Bass, and they have three children together. They reside in a $40 million mansion in Fort Worth, Texas.
